




Job Summary: The professional will act as the team’s technical reference, leading architecture, solving complex problems, and elevating the team’s technical level. Key Highlights: 1. Technical leadership and architectural consistency in deliveries. 2. Design and evolution of innovative backend and frontend architectures. 3. Involvement in governance, observability, security, and resilience. **About GO.K** We are innovation and technology accelerators for enterprises since 2009. We focus on innovative solutions aimed at driving business growth and delivering exceptional results to our clients. We support projects from diagnosis through implementation—digital initiatives with high technical and business complexity, operating in transactional, regulated environments demanding stringent quality, security, performance, observability, and governance standards. **About the Opportunity** The professional will serve as the team’s technical reference, responsible for designing, maintaining, and evolving the architecture; unblocking complex problems; guiding technical decisions; and leading by example—including writing code when necessary. **Responsibilities** * Act as the team’s technical leader, ensuring architectural consistency and delivery quality. * Design and evolve backend and frontend architectures aligned with business and non-functional requirements. * Define technical standards, best practices, and development guidelines. * Actively resolve technical blockers and structural issues. * Support the team in complex technical decisions and architecture reviews. * Write code when necessary—especially for critical or foundational components. * Ensure consistent integration among frontend, BFF, and backend. * Drive technical governance, observability, security, and resilience of solutions. * Collaborate closely with Product Owners, UX designers, QA engineers, and technical stakeholders. * Elevate the team’s technical level through ongoing guidance and review. **Technical Skills** * Modern Java (17+ / 21+) * Spring Boot and/or Micronaut * Advanced React, with deep expertise in frontend architecture * Microservices and BFF architecture * REST API design and versioning * Event-driven architectures and asynchronous processing * Integration across critical systems (REST, events, webhooks) * Authentication and authorization (OAuth2, JWT, RBAC) * Resilience strategies (retry, circuit breaker, timeout, fallback) * Data persistence (relational and event-driven) * Messaging systems (Kafka, SQS, RabbitMQ or similar) * End-to-end observability (logs, metrics, distributed tracing) * Application security (OWASP Top 10, data protection) * Containers and orchestration (Docker, Kubernetes) * CI/CD and continuous delivery practices * Code quality tools (Sonar or similar) * Git in collaborative environments (PRs, code reviews) **Nice-to-Have** * Prior experience as Tech Lead or Architect for mission-critical products * Experience in financial or regulated environments * Proven track record supporting production systems * Experience with high-volume projects and strict SLAs * Experience working in distributed teams and complex corporate environments


